Lil Jon, The Orchard Ink Deal
August 05, 2008

By Hillary Crosley, N.Y.

Lil Jon and The Orchard have announced a content partnership deal, which includes brand marketing and A&R direction. The Orchard purchased TVT Records, to which Lil Jon was previously signed, in June.

"I walked into The Orchard and came away with the sweet taste of freedom!" said Lil Jon. "Others talk, the Orchard does. I expect to do great things with them, and look forward to my future."

Lil Jon recently withdrew his multi-million-dollar objection to the TVT sale proceedings and agreed to TVT's transfer of his artist agreement to the Orchard. In turn, the Orchard has released Lil Jon from all future obligations under his previous TVT contract and agreed to give him the rights to his master recordings for his oft-delayed LP, "Crunk Rock." While the LP will not released via the Orchard, a digital reissue of the MC/producer's back catalogue, which the company now owns, along with new content will be released in the future. No release dates have been set for either LP.

Lil Jon will contribute to the Orchard's brand entertainment group by working with agencies to develop lifestyle-oriented marketing and promotion programs. The MC/producer will also contribute A&R and production support to the Orchard's artists and labels.

Lil Jon's last album, 2004's "Crunk Juice," has sold 2.5 million copies according to Nielsen SoundScan.
